Most criminals, in any part of society, are convinced that they are not going to get caught. Robbers, thieves, speeders, drug illiciters, insurance scammers, tax cheats and sports cheats are all sure that 'everyone does it' and expect that they're not speeding so fast that the cops must pay attention to them, or that the city will bother to prosecute one guy out of a thousand violators. They feel confident with their chances whether or not it's justified.
